Biography of Ronnie Coleman

Ronnie Dean Coleman was born on May 13, 1964, in Monroe, Louisiana. He grew up in a modest family and developed an interest in sports at an early age. Coleman attended Grambling State University, where he earned a degree in accounting. However, his passion for bodybuilding grew stronger as he started lifting weights during his college days.

After college, Coleman began working as a police officer in Arlington, Texas. It was during this time that he decided to pursue bodybuilding seriously. His dedication and hard work led him to compete in various bodybuilding contests, eventually earning him his professional card.

Ronnie Coleman’s Training Regimen

Ronnie Coleman’s training regimen is legendary and often cited as one of the most intense in the bodybuilding community. His workouts typically involved heavy lifting and high volume, which contributed to his phenomenal muscle growth. Here are some key aspects of his training:

  • Heavy Lifting: Coleman's philosophy centered around lifting heavy weights to build mass. He often performed exercises such as squats, deadlifts, and bench presses with weights that many would find daunting.
  • High Volume: Coleman would often perform 4-6 sets of 10-12 repetitions for each exercise, maximizing his time in the gym.
  • Split Training: He followed a split training routine, focusing on different muscle groups on different days, allowing for targeted muscle growth.
  • Consistency: Consistency was key for Coleman. He trained 6 days a week, ensuring that he maintained his physique year-round.

Challenges Faced by Ronnie Coleman

Despite his success, Ronnie Coleman faced several challenges throughout his career. From injuries to the physical toll of competing at such a high level, Coleman’s journey was not without its difficulties.

One of the most significant challenges came after his retirement from competitive bodybuilding. Coleman underwent multiple surgeries due to severe back and hip injuries caused by years of heavy lifting. These surgeries affected his mobility and necessitated a long rehabilitation process.
